Maknakhor

Maknakhor is a village located in Bansi tehsil of Siddharthnag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 31km away from sub-district headquarter Bansi (tehsildar office) and 53km away from district headquarter Siddharthnagar. As per 2009 stats, Nikhoria is the gram panchayat of Maknakhor village.

About Maknakhor

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Maknakhor is 177544. The village spans a total geographical area of 43.03 hectares. Siddharthnagar is nearest town to Maknakhor village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 30km away.

Population of Maknakhor

Below is a concise population overview of Maknakhor as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 632 337 295
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 129 72 57
Scheduled Castes (SC) 345 178 167
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 46 25 21
Literate Population 277 183 94
Illiterate Population 355 154 201

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Maknakhor village:

  • The total population of Maknakhor village is around 632, including approximately 337 males and 295 females, with a sex ratio of 875 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 129 children aged 0–6 years in Maknakhor village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Maknakhor village has 345 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 46 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Maknakhor village is about 43.83%, with male literacy at 54.30% and female literacy at 31.86%.
  • There are around 97 households in Maknakhor village.

Connectivity of Maknakhor

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Maknakhor. As per the 2011 stats, Maknakhor had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
